Monte Laura is located above the village of Roveredo at 1400 meters above sea level, and can be reached by an 11 km long road that starts from the village, of which Laura is a fraction.

The church of San Rocco, located on the beautiful hill of Carasole, is mentioned for the first time in 1481, while in the seventeenth century the building was the subject of renovations.

The chapel of Sant'Antonio de Bolada, located between the Mounts of Sta. Maria i.C. and Braggio, was built during the plague of 1620, to save the population from the terrible scourge.
